UN Security Council: Gas is immersed in a disaster, the western coast was overwhelmed by violence Peace and safety ~ 60 > “Today the world observes horror how the situation continues to deteriorate in the occupied Palestinian territories – to a level unprecedented in recent history.” With such a statement at a meeting of the UN Security Council, the deputy special coordinator for the Middle East peaceful process Ramiz Alakbarov made. 62 ~ he said that in recent months the sector has ended up at the epicenter of the humanitarian crisis: “Gas is immersed in a catastrophe, which is characterized by a rapid increase in the number of victims among the civilian population, mass movements and now also hunger.” Deputy Special Cordrator noted that “hostages held by Hamas and other armed Palestinian groups, & nbsp; are still in terrifying conditions.” ~ 60 >~ 60 > 62 >From July 23, according to the Gaza Ministry of Health, at least 2553 Palestinians were killed, including 271 people who died while trying to receive humanitarian aid. & Amp; nbsp; schools, hospital and residential buildings were subjected to attacks. Alakbarov paid special attention to the death of representatives of the press: “Since the beginning of the conflict in Gaza, more than 240 journalists have been killed. The Israeli air jurisd with a tent in which the journalists were in Gaza on August 10 led to the death of six people. ” ~ ~ > talking about his recent Gaza trip, Alakbarov said that he was shocked by the scale of destruction and human suffering:“ I met humanitors living in non -incomparable conditions risking. life for help for others violence on the western shore ~ ​​60 ~ h2 >~ 60 > 62 > 62 > 62 > 62 >Alakbarov noted that the territory intended to create the future Palestinian state is reduced, while “the reality of the existence of one state with illegal occupation and constant violence is rapidly strengthened.” Deputy Special Cordrator spoke about the ongoing operations of Israeli forces in Palestinian cities and refugee camps, as a result of which more than 32 thousand people have recently been moved. ~ 60 > ~ ~ > Alakbarov specially highlighted the case of the murder of the Israeli Palestinian activist of the Audi of Khatalin. The eyes of his five -year -old son: “When I held a watan in my arms, I thought about the tragedy of his future life – without a father and with a constant threat of violence and eviction.” ~ 60 > call for immediately the ceasefire 62 > 62 ~ 62Alakbarov called for the “immediate, complete and strong end of fire and the unconditional liberation of all hostages.” He also expressed concern about Israel’s decision to capture the city of gas and expand military operations, which can lead to “catastrophic consequences.” ~ 60 > 60 > at the end of his speech, Alakarov welcomed the fact of a high -level conference organized by France and Saudi Arabia, Having emphasized: “The message of the international community is extremely clear: the decision on the two states remains the only viable way to the fair and sustainable settlement of the Israeli-Palestinian conflict.” ~ 60 > hunger in the gas-“artificially created disaster ” 60 > deputy coordinator of the UN Extraordinary Assistance and assistant secretary general for humanitarian issues, Joyce Msuya, speaking at a meeting of the Security Council, noted that at present more than half a million people in gas are faced with hunger and poverty and by the end of September this number may exceed 640 thousands. It is expected that from the present until the middle of next year, at least 132 thousand children under the age of five will suffer from acute malnutrition, and the number of those who can die will triple, exceeding 43 thousand. Among pregnant women and nursing women, this indicator, according to forecasts, will increase from 17 thousand to 55 thousand. ~ 60 > “Let’s clarify: this hunger is not the result of drought or any natural catastrophe,” Joyce Msuya emphasized. – This is an artificially created catastrophe – the result of a conflict that led to mass deaths and injuries of the civilian population, destruction and forced movement. ”~ 60 >~ 60 > Put an end to the“ artificial crisis ” msuya called the Council of Security to ensure the council of security to ensure Immediate termination of hostilities in order to save life and stop the spread of hunger. She also demanded immediately and without any conditions to free all the hostages, protect the civilian population and critically important infrastructure. ~ ~ 60 > In addition, she emphasized, it is necessary to provide a safe, quick and unhindered humanitarian access through all points of entry into the sector so that the help was allowed to be delivered to everyone those in need. “to put an end to this man -made crisis, we must act as if our mothers, fathers, children, our families tried to survive today in gas,” said Joyce Musya. 62 > 62 > 62 > 62 > 62 > 62 > 62 ~
